A Poem by Allie Burris
"

This Poem basically is saying that you shouldn't always be depressed and try and see the good in anything you do or in everyone/ everything.

"
What do we see in everyday life?
Depression? Deprivation? Sadness?
These emotions, feelings, are in everyone's hearts and souls.
We see it where ever we go.
A store, a party, a book club meeting, anywhere we go.
It's even in you.
That feeling weighs down our heart making it heavy to breathe.
You feel so lost, so depressed.
You sit there all alone, no one to hold you, caress your hands or your face to tell you "It will be alright."
Your heart has turned to dust...the feelings of love and happiness.
Gone in the wind, flowing through your fingers, your hair, your heart...
Your soul is crushed, your heart is stone.
What else can you do with all these tears around you?
You see others cry, cut themselves, even do suicide.
Take a stand, take a chance, make a change in yourself.
Go and help others and you will feel better about yourself.
Don't let the bad things and negative sides of anything take you over.
That bright side will always be there for you and will always welcome you there.
Take the good side in things before the bad sides cloud your vision and decisions in everyday situations.
You will always have someone or something there to show you, to help you, to be there for you.
Take chances, make changes in anyone's life, even yours. 
When you look back to the past when your time is near you'll rest in peace remembering all the good you've done in your life and others.
